Shearman & Sterling Represents Underwriters in Three Public Offerings for BB&T Corporation

Shearman & Sterling represented Banc of America Securities LLC, Morgan Stanley & Co. Incorporated, Wells Fargo Securities, LLC, BB&T Capital Markets, a division of Scott & Stringfellow, LLC and UBS Securities LLC, as joint lead managers and bookrunners and RBC Capital Markets Corporation, as co-manager, in connection with an offering by BB&T Corporation and BB&T Capital Trust VI consisting of 23,000,000 Enhanced Trust Preferred Securities of the Trust, which included the exercise in full of the underwriters’ over-allotment option to purchase an additional 3,000,000 Enhanced Trust Preferred Securities, for net proceeds of approximately $557 million.

Shearman & Sterling also represented BB&T Capital Markets, a division of Scott & Stringfellow, LLC, Morgan Stanley & Co. Incorporated and UBS Securities LLC, as joint bookrunners and Barclays Capital Inc., as sole bookrunner, in connection with two separate offerings by BB&T Corporation under its existing Medium-Term Note Program, of $1,000,000,000 in aggregate principal amount of 3.85% Senior Notes due 2012 and $250,000,000 in aggregate principal amount of 3.10% Senior Notes due 2011, for net proceeds of approximately $1.25 billion.

The following Shearman & Sterling team advised the underwriters in the transactions: partners Michael Schiavone (New York-Capital Markets), Lona Nallengara (New York-Capital Markets) and Craig Gibian (Washington, DC-Tax) and associates Kevin Roggow (New York-Capital Markets), Ann Matthews (New York-Capital Markets) David Ni (New York-Capital Markets) and Patrick Valenti (Washington, DC-Tax).
